Key Responsibilities:
- Develop and maintain Configuration Management Plans and procedures
- Establish and manage baselines (functional, allocated, and product)
- Manage and control engineering changes through Change Control Boards (CCBs)
- Maintain and audit Bill of Materials (BOMs), Engineering Change Notices (ECNs), and technical documentation
- Support product lifecycle activities from concept through sustainment
- Interface with engineering, manufacturing, quality assurance, supply chain, and program management teams
- Manage configuration control databases and Product Data Management (PDM) systems (e.g., SolidWorks PDM, Windchill)
- Conduct configuration audits (Functional Configuration Audit, Physical Configuration Audit)
- Ensure configuration records are accurate and up to date for customer delivery and regulatory compliance
